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 35, West Street, Oxford is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£501,959 and a rental value of £2,018 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£444,592 and a rental value of £1,787 per month.

Energy Efficiency
35, West Street, Oxford has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 02 Feb 2017.
The property is connected to mains gas and has partial double glazing.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
Sold Prices
According to HM Land Registry, 35, West Street, Oxford was last sold on 26th May 2017 for £432,500 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has had 4 sales since 1995.
Since May 2017, the market for similar properties has risen by 13.6%.
- Sold May 2017£432,500
- Sold Apr 2011£325,000
- Sold Dec 2004£265,000
